How to get from Brooklyn to Long Island City by bus and subway?
From Brooklyn to Long Island City by bus and subway
To get from Brooklyn to Long Island City in Queens,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 subway lines: take the B6 bus from Ashford St/Cozine Av station to Livonia Av/Ashford St station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 4 subway and finally take the 7 subway from Grand Central-42 St station to Vernon Blvd-Jackson Av station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 20 min. The ride fare is $2.90.

Alternative route from Brooklyn to Long Island City by bus and subway via B6, L and G
To get from Brooklyn to Long Island City in Queens,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 subway lines: take the B6 bus from Cozine Av/Ashford St station to Rockaway Subway Station/Glenwood station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the L subway and finally take the G subway from Metropolitan Av station to 21 St station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 20 min. The ride fare is $2.90.
